如何同时使用 NVidia Gpu 和英特尔高清显卡

如何同时使用 NVidia Gpu 和英特尔高清显卡

我的笔记本电脑配有高端 NVidia Geforce GTX 860m 显卡和英特尔集成显卡(英特尔 HD 4600,相当弱)

因此就我而言,我必须在 ue4 中工作(对显卡的要求很高),同时不时切换到浏览器观看教程并寻找问题的答案。

那么有没有办法使用 NVidia 卡执行繁重任务,同时使用英特尔显卡浏览网页?因为目前视频非常卡顿,甚至网络表单也很难填写(打字时延迟很大)
如果有人能解决这个问题,我将非常感谢他。

此外,我的问题不是这里描述的问题:如何使用 Intel HD Graphics 进行常规桌面使用,同时仅使用我的 NVIDIA GPU 进行 DNN 训练
因为我不想在 GPU 之间切换,而是想同时运行它们。

答案1

根据您在http://ubuntuforums.org/showthread.php?t=2291771并且那里的答案是,你所要求的是不可能的。

来自论坛:

从我对 Nvidia Optimus 技术的理解来看,我认为这是不可能的。Optimus 的目的是自动在更强大的 GPU 之间切换,以执行高强度图形任务,但同样耗电高;在低强度图形任务时,自动在更强大的 GPU 之间切换,但电池消耗较少。

在 Linux 中我们尚未获得可进行自动切换的 Nvidia 驱动程序。

我猜你在视频播放时遇到的问题与使用哪种 GPU 无关,而是与 CPU 处于密集使用状态并需要任务切换有关。Nvidia GPU 应该可以轻松处理视频播放。如果不能,那么可能是因为同时进行的任务太多了。

另一方面,您可以尝试bumblebee/optirun按照在 14.04 中正确设置 nvidia+intel 显卡

然后,您可以ue4从前缀开始,从而使用 Nvidia 卡,并使用 Intel 进行浏览器等其他进程。按 ++打开optirun终端并输入:CtrlAltT

(optirun <name of the program> &)

(括号)和&将使进程与终端分离。这将允许您在启动程序后在终端上工作。 还有其他方法可以将程序与终端完全分离

另请参阅大黄蜂 optirun 实际上是如何起作用的?

我没有 Nvidia 卡,所以我没有尝试过。

希望这可以帮助

相关内容